For a long time, the stories of the Chickasaws have been told primarily by others. Chickasaw scholars have little outlet for their work and leading publishers have shown only limited interest. One of the ways the Chickasaw Nation is addressing this challenge is through the Chickasaw Press. Framed as a service to the Nation, the Press operates with the full support of the tribal government. It publishes books written by Chickasaw citizens and by others, using the highest standards of professional editing and production. In doing so, it gives new life to an ancient storytelling tradition.
